A Tableau Software Case Study
Southwest Airlines, the U.S.’s largest domestic carrier with 700+ aircraft and about 4,000 daily flights, faced fragmented data across legacy systems (Excel, Access, Oracle, Teradata, etc.) and 28+ departments, which made it hard to get an enterprise view of operations, on‑time performance, and maintenance status. Siloed, inconsistent data slowed decision‑making and prevented real‑time insights needed to optimize schedules, fleet health, and customer experience.
Southwest adopted Tableau to enable self‑service analytics and a single source of truth, scaling from 3 to ~2,900 active users and deploying 400 Desktop licenses across 36 departments. Real‑time dashboards (updated every 15 minutes for OTP) and consolidated visualizations improved maintenance monitoring, route and capacity planning, fuel tankering decisions, and reservation center forecasting—cutting reporting time, surfacing new revenue and cost‑saving opportunities, and publishing over 2,000 workbooks that boosted collaboration and morale.
